8.2.2 Event Screens
Press the EVENTS pushbutton on the main menu bar or History Menu bar to display a
listing of all system events that are currently active. The most recent event is listed
first. As events clear, they are removed from the Active System Events listing.
Figure 8‐4 shows the Active Events screen.

NNOOTTEE The UNIT designation after the meter type, and the SYSTEM and UNIT menu bar
pushbutton selections, are visible only when a parallel system is installed.
The Output screen shows output voltage (phase–to–neutral), output current (each phase), and frequency being
supplied by the UPS, as well as the kVA, kW, and power factor measurements.
